** The Nissan repair market serving Spotsylvania, VA, is characterized by a clear tiered structure. The single most specialized option is the franchised Nissan dealership in Fredericksburg, which offers the highest level of brand-specific certification and equipment, particularly for newer models, complex electronics, and performance vehicles like the GT-R. This comes with a premium price, as dealership labor rates and OEM parts are typically the most expensive. The independent shop market is robust and provides high-quality alternatives. Shops like AutoStop and Import Auto Service have cultivated specific expertise in Nissan vehicles, often staffed by technicians with prior dealership experience. They compete effectively on price (generally 15-30% lower labor rates than the dealer) and personalized service, making them ideal for out-of-warranty vehicles, routine maintenance, and repairs where aftermarket or rebuilt parts are a cost-effective option. Competition among these top independents is strong, driving a high standard of quality and customer care. For a Spotsylvania resident, the choice often comes down to the specific repair needed, the value of factory certification versus independent expertise, and personal budget considerations.

Due to our area's mix of highway commuting and rural roads, common issues include CVT transmission service for models like the Altima and Rogue, brake wear from stop-and-go traffic, and suspension components affected by local road conditions. Nissans are also frequently seen for check engine lights related to oxygen sensors and mass airflow sensors.
Look for shops with ASE-certified technicians, especially those with specific Nissan or Japanese brand training. Check reviews mentioning long-term Nissan repair success, and consider established local shops that source parts from the Fredericksburg area dealerships or reputable distributors to ensure proper fit and function.
Typically, independent repair shops in Spotsylvania offer more competitive labor rates than the Fredericksburg dealership, while using the same quality parts. For complex computer or hybrid system issues, the dealership's specialized tools may be necessary, but for most repairs, a qualified local independent can provide significant savings.
Seek immediate service if you experience overheating, especially before summer, as our Virginia humidity strains cooling systems. Also, address any warning lights like the brake or oil pressure light immediately, as driving on Spotsylvania's hills and highways with these issues can lead to major damage.
Our seasonal changes demand attention to battery health before winter and air conditioning service before summer. Furthermore, the prevalence of road salt in winter and gravel on rural roads makes regular undercarriage inspections and more frequent cabin air filter changes advisable to combat rust and dust.
